Product Details: Apidra Solostar Sanofi, formulation and purpose
Apidra Solostar is a rapid-acting insulin analogue manufactured by Sanofi, designed specifically for those managing conditions like Type 1 and Type 2 diabetes. The active ingredient in Apidra is insulin glulisine, a synthetic form of human insulin that works quicker than standard insulin formulations. This speed is particularly beneficial for managing blood glucose levels around meal times.
The product comes in a user-friendly pen format, known as the Solostar pen, which provides a convenient method for administration. Each pen typically contains 3 mL of insulin glulisine, with a set dosing mechanism to administer precise amounts. This formulation mimics the body’s natural insulin response to food intake, making it an essential tool for individuals aiming to maintain optimal blood sugar control.

Side Effects, health and safety precautions
Like all medications, Apidra Solostar is associated with potential side effects. While many users tolerate the medication well, some common side effects can include:
– Hypoglycemia (low blood sugar)
– Injection site reactions (redness or swelling)
– Weight gain
– Allergic reactions (rare but possible)
To mitigate these risks, users should be well-informed about recognizing the symptoms of low blood sugar and have emergency measures in place. Regular monitoring of blood sugar levels is vital, especially when initiating therapy with Apidra or adjusting dosages.
Safety precautions include disclosing any current medications or existing health conditions to your healthcare provider, particularly endocrine disorders and potential interactions with other drugs. Instructions for Use
To maximize the benefits of Apidra Solostar and minimize potential risks, adhere to the following instructions:
- Always administer Apidra just before or immediately after meals to make the most of its rapid action.
- Rotate injection sites to reduce the risk of lipodystrophy (fat accumulation or loss at injection sites).
- Store pens in a refrigerator before opening; however, once in use, they may be kept at room temperature for a limited period.
- Regularly monitor blood glucose to adjust doses as needed; this is especially important for individuals with intense athletic training schedules.
- Never share your pen with others to avoid transmission of infections.
